🔍 Detailed Explanation of Fact Families
Fact families are groups of related addition and subtraction facts that use the same numbers. Understanding fact families helps us see how addition and subtraction are connected. For example, if we know 3 + 5 = 8, we can also know 5 + 3 = 8. From there, we can find related subtraction facts: 8 – 3 = 5 and 8 – 5 = 3. These four facts belong to one fact family.
In Year 3 Maths, according to the UK National Curriculum, fact families play an important role in developing number sense and fluency with addition and subtraction. By learning fact families, Key Stage 2 students improve their ability to solve problems and understand how numbers work together. This understanding also helps with mental maths, making it quicker to calculate answers in everyday situations.
Here are some examples of fact families suitable for Year 3 students:
- Fact family for numbers 4, 7, and 11:
- 4 + 7 = 11
- 7 + 4 = 11
- 11 – 4 = 7
- 11 – 7 = 4
- Fact family for numbers 6, 9, and 15:
- 6 + 9 = 15
- 9 + 6 = 15
- 15 – 6 = 9
- 15 – 9 = 6
Remember, learning fact families helps you understand that addition and subtraction are closely linked. Practising with fact families makes you faster at solving number problems and builds a strong foundation for more difficult maths later on. What is a Fact Family? 🤔
A fact family is a group of related addition and subtraction (or multiplication and division) facts using the same numbers. In Key Stage 2, we focus mainly on addition and subtraction fact families to build strong number bonds and improve mental maths skills.
Example of a Fact Family:
For the numbers 5, 3, and 8, the fact family includes these four sums:
- 3 + 5 = 8
- 5 + 3 = 8
- 8 – 3 = 5
- 8 – 5 = 3

Study Tips for Fact Families 📚
- Always write the addition facts first, as addition joins two parts to make a whole.
- Then write the subtraction facts by subtracting each smaller number from the biggest number.
- Practise with number bonds you know well to get quicker.
- Use objects like cubes or counters to see the facts in real life.
- Remember, fact families help with mental maths and understanding how numbers work together.
